Danger Mitigation in Estate Administration



Exactly how can probate bonds assist you alleviate risks in estate administration?

Probate bonds act as a useful tool in protecting the interests of the estate and its recipients. By calling for the executor or administrator to acquire a probate bond, the court guarantees that the individual dealing with the estate acts according to the law and satisfies their obligations responsibly.

In the regrettable occasion of mismanagement or misbehavior, the probate bond supplies a financial safety net. If the administrator violations their fiduciary responsibilities, leading to monetary losses to the estate or recipients, the bond can be utilized to make up for these damages. This security supplies satisfaction to the beneficiaries, knowing that there's an option available in case of any type of messing up of estate properties.

In addition, probate bonds assist discourage possible misbehavior, as the executor is aware of the consequences of their actions. Consequently, by requiring a probate bond, you can proactively alleviate risks and guarantee the correct administration of the estate.

Defense for Recipients' Passions



To make sure the security of recipients' interests, probate bonds play a vital duty in estate management by providing a monetary safeguard in cases of mismanagement or transgression. These bonds act as a form of insurance policy that safeguards the recipients from possible losses because of the activities of the estate executor or administrator.

In situations where the executor stops working to fulfill their duties effectively or takes part in deceptive activities, the probate bond ensures that the recipients get their entitled properties. This security is crucial for recipients who might not have direct control over the estate's administration and need assurance that their interests are protected.
